The aim of this research is to determine the effect of the Dividend Payout Ratio (DPR) on share prices. To determine the effect of Return On Assets (ROA) on share prices. This research uses secondary data in the form of company financial reports. Sampling used purposive sampling. Data analysis uses the classic assumption test. Multiple linear regression test. The population in this study are food and beverage sector man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ange for the 2021-2023 period with a total sample of 21 companies. Data processing in this research uses the SPSS (Statistical Package for the Social Science) 26 software program. Based on research conducted on 21 Manufacturing Companies in the Food and Beverage Subsector on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in 2021-2023. So it can be concluded that the Dividend Payout Ratio (X1) has no significant effect on share prices with a calculated t value of 0.522 and a significant value of 0.546 0.05. The results of testing the second hypothesis show that Return On Assets (X2) has a significant effect on Share Prices (Y) with a calculated t value of 0.374 and a significant value of 0.021<0.05
